[0001] Support device for supporting a back of a human body
[0002] The invention relates to a support device for supporting a back of a human body, in particular in a sitting position on a floor.
[0003] Camping chairs, folding chairs and stools currently on the market usually offer a seating position raised above the ground and, thanks to different leg lengths, allow for a wide variety of seat heights. Even if this height is very low, the user always loses a more direct sense of nature and surroundings compared to sitting directly on the ground. For thousands of years, people have therefore enjoyed sitting directly on the ground because it is the most natural way of sitting. Even today, people still like to sit on the ground when they want to relax or rest, especially in their free time, for example in a park, by a lake, by the sea, by a river, by a campfire or at home.
[0004] However, existing floor seating systems lack comprehensive seating comfort features for sitting at ground level, such as universal adjustment or leaning functions for the head and / or back. Furthermore, they are too bulky, too wide, too heavy, not stable enough, have insufficient structural properties, and / or are ergonomically uncomfortable.
[0005] The object underlying the invention is therefore to solve the above-mentioned problems and to provide a floor seating device or a support device for supporting the back of a human body, in particular in a sitting position on a floor. This object is achieved by a support device according to claim 1.
[0006] Advantageous further developments of the invention are contained in the dependent claims.
[0007] According to one aspect of the invention, a support device for supporting the back of a human body, in particular in a sitting position on a floor, comprises: a rigid backrest with a backrest surface configured to support the back, wherein the backrest surface has an elongated recess with a first longitudinal direction. The support device further comprises an elongated floor support device with a second longitudinal direction and with a first end and a second end opposite along the second longitudinal direction.The backrest has a joint on a side opposite the backrest surface, which is designed to connect the floor support device to the backrest in the region of its first end so that it can pivot about a first pivot axis perpendicular to the first longitudinal direction of the recess by a pivot angle, such that the floor support device is designed to be folded onto the backrest and pivoted away from it. The floor support device has an elongated floor support component in the second longitudinal direction of the floor support device and a first pivot angle limiting device, and the floor support component has a first floor support component end and a second floor support component end.The first floor support component end is connected to the backrest, the second floor support component end is configured to bear against the floor, and the first pivot angle limiting device is configured to limit a pivot angle of the floor support component to the backrest to a predefined angle.
[0008] The backrest surface is designed to support the back, ensuring that the backrest surface is at least partially adapted to the contours of the back and that it does not cause an uncomfortable point load, even if it is at least partially straight. For example, it could be formed by two slats, for example, made of wood.
[0009] The elongated recess in the backrest surface is either formed by a depression, so that the backrest has a material that is continuous across the recess, or it is formed by a cutout, which is an opening that is continuous in the thickness direction of the backrest. For stability reasons, however, it is advantageous if the backrest is connected continuously in its width direction, either integrally or via a separate element, at least at its upper end and its lower end, which are located during intended use.
[0010] The joint, which pivots the floor support at its first end on the side opposite the backrest, allows for an ergonomically favorable support position on the back, allowing the user to adjust the angle of inclination of the backrest to a comfortable level. The joint also enables a statically stable connection between the backrest and the floor support. The joint allows the floor support to be folded onto the backrest and placed in a transport position, making the floor support as compact as possible and easy to transport.
[0011] The end opposite the first end of the ground support device in the second longitudinal direction can either be supported directly thereon, for example in the case of soft ground such as sandy ground, or can also be supported, for example, on a tree or a wall, in which case the ground support device does not necessarily have to be additionally supported on the ground.
[0012] With the aid of the pivot angle limiting device, the pivot angle of the floor support component relative to the backrest can be limited, thus adjusting the inclination of the backrest. In an advantageous further development of the support device, the recess extends in the first longitudinal direction at least to one end of the backrest surface.
[0013] By forming the recess at least up to one end of the backrest surface, so that the recess is also reflected in the front surface of one end, the spine can be exposed and it is prevented that a quasi-point load is created on the spine at one end, which would cause an unpleasant sitting feeling and pain.
[0014] In an advantageous development of the support device, the recess has a width in a range of 2.5 cm to 7 cm, preferably in a range of 3 cm to 5 cm, and a depth of at least 0.5 cm.
[0015] In an advantageous development, the first pivot angle limiting device comprises a rope- or chain-like element with a first fastening point and a second fastening point, with a predefined length therebetween. The pivot angle limiting device is connected to the first fastening point in a region of a lower end of the backrest during intended use, i.e., closer to the lower end of the backrest, and is connected to the floor support device at the second fastening point in a region of the second end of the floor support device, i.e., closer to the second end.
[0016] The attachment points are either nodes connecting the rope-like element to the backrest or the floor support device, or, for example, points where the rope-like element wraps around or is otherwise connected to the backrest or the floor support device, or a respective element thereof. The length of the rope-like element between the attachment points can be selected by appropriate knotting, wrapping, or other connection, allowing different pivot angles of the floor support device relative to the backrest to be selected in order to adjust the angle of the backrest to the floor for a comfortable and ergonomic sitting position.
[0017] According to another advantageous development, the pivot angle limiting device has a rod-like support element with a first rod end and a second rod end and with a predetermined length, wherein the rod-like support element is connected to the backrest at the first rod end in a region of an end of the backrest which is at the top during intended use, and the floor support component has a floor support component fixing device by means of which the rod-like support element can be connected to the second rod end at a predefined location on the floor support component.
[0018] Advantageously, the ground support component has a plurality of ground support component fixing devices along the second longitudinal direction of the ground support device, and the rod-like support element can be fixed to the ground support component at the second rod end by means of the ground support component fixing devices.
[0019] Advantageously, on the other hand, the rod-like support element has a plurality of support element fixing devices along its length, and the rod-like support element can be fixed to the ground support component by means of one of the support element fixing devices.
[0020] In an advantageous development of the support device, the ground support component has two ground support component sections pivotably connected to one another about a second pivot axis perpendicular to the second longitudinal direction of the ground support device, and a second pivot angle limiting device is provided and designed to limit a pivot angle of the two ground support component sections.According to an advantageous development of the support device, the second pivot angle limiting device has two pivot angle limiting device sections pivotally connected to one another about a third pivot axis perpendicular to the second longitudinal direction of the ground support device, one end of one of the pivot angle limiting device sections is connected to one of the ground support component sections of the ground support component in the region of the first ground support component end, and one end of the other of the pivot angle limiting device sections is connected to the other of the ground support component sections of the ground support component in the region of the second ground support component end.
[0021] In an advantageous embodiment of the support device, it has a seat cushion which is connected to an end of the backrest which is located at the bottom during normal use.
[0022] In a further advantageous embodiment of the support device, it has a headrest at the end of the backrest which is at the top during normal use, wherein the support device has a mounting device with which the headrest is mounted on the backrest in such a way that it is designed to be adjustable and lockable parallel to the first longitudinal direction.
[0023] In an advantageous embodiment of the support device, it has a headrest at the end of the backrest which is at the top during normal use, wherein the support device has a mounting device with which the headrest is mounted on the backrest in such a way that it is designed to be adjustable and lockable parallel to a direction perpendicular to the first longitudinal direction and at a right angle to the backrest surface.
[0024] By providing a headrest with adjustable options, an ergonomically favorable head posture can be supported in sitting positions with different back inclinations for different body sizes. Advantageously, the width of the backrest of the support device along the first pivot axis corresponds at most to the width of the floor support device along the first pivot axis.

[0030] Fig. 1 shows a support device 1 not belonging to the invention for supporting a back of a human body, in particular in a sitting position on a floor, obliquely from the front.
[0031] The support device 1 comprises a rigid backrest 2 with a backrest surface 3 designed to support the back. Furthermore, the support device 1 comprises an elongated floor support device 4.
[0032] The backrest surface 3 has an elongated recess 5 with a longitudinal direction LR1. In the illustrated embodiment, the recess 5 extends in the first longitudinal direction LR1 to both ends of the backrest surface 3, so that it is reflected in the respective end face at these ends. In an alternative embodiment, the recess 5 extends only to one end of the backrest surface 3. In the illustrated embodiment, the backrest 2 is formed from two bars 6 that are connected by two struts 7. The backrest 2 is rigid, which means that it essentially does not deform when the back is leaned against the backrest 2. Optionally, however, the backrest 2 can be provided with flexible padding, in which case a rigid support material is provided.The suitability of the backrest surface 3 for supporting the back is ensured by the fact that it is approximately adapted to the contour of the back, at least in sections. However, it can also be straight, as in the illustrated embodiment, and has a sufficient length so that no point load occurs on the back. In alternative embodiments, the backrest 2 can also be formed in one piece, for example from a plastic molded part, with the recess 5 then being molded into the plastic molded part.
[0033] The recess 5 is formed as a continuous cutout, with the exception of the two recessed struts 7. In alternative embodiments, the recess 5 is formed as a depression that does not extend through the entire thickness of the backrest 2. The recess 5 has a width of 3 cm here, but can have a width in a range of 2.5 cm to 7 cm, preferably in a range of 3 cm to 5 cm, and a depth of at least 0.5 cm, here 4 cm.
[0034] The ground support device 4 has a second longitudinal direction LR2 and a first end 4.1 and a second end 4.2 opposite along the longitudinal direction LR2.
[0035] The backrest 2 has a joint 8 on a side opposite the backrest surface 3, which pivotably connects the floor support device 4 to the backrest 2 in the region of its first end 4.1 about a first pivot axis 9 perpendicular to the first longitudinal direction LR1 of the recess 5. This allows the floor support device 4 to be folded onto the backrest 2 and pivoted away from it. The definition "in the region of one end" in this patent application means, for example, that a connection is closer to this end than to the opposite end.
[0036] The support device 1 shown in Fig. 1 has a seat cushion 10 having a rope-like fastening device 11. The rope-like fastening device 11 is connected to the ground support device 4 in a region of the second end 4.2 of the ground support device 4, i.e., closer to the second end 4.2 than to the first end 4.1, and secured with a knot. The seat cushion is flexible, so that when the support device 1 is folded up, it does not unfavorably increase its dimensions. In alternative embodiments, the rope-like fastening device 11 can wrap around the ground support device 4 or be attached in some other way, instead of being secured with a knot.In further alternative embodiments, the seat cushion is rigid with a minimum possible width, or no seat cushion 10 is provided, wherein the floor support device 4 is then supported on a raised area in the floor, or for example on a flexible floor.
[0037] The width of the backrest 2 along the first pivot axis 9 corresponds to a maximum width of the floor support device 4 along the first pivot axis 9. This ensures that the support device 1 is as narrow as possible in order to transport the support device 1 comfortably.
[0038] Fig. 2 shows an isometric view of a first embodiment of the support device 1 according to the invention from an angle behind.
[0039] The first embodiment of the support device 1 according to the invention differs from the first embodiment in that the ground support device 4 has an elongated ground support component 12 in the second longitudinal direction LR2 of the ground support device 4 and a first pivot angle limiting device 13.
[0040] The ground support component 12 has a first ground support component end 12.1 and a second ground support component end 12.2. The first ground support component end 12.1 is connected to the backrest 2, and the second ground support component end 12.2 is designed to bear against the ground. The ability to bear against the ground also means that the ground support component 12 can also bear against another surface on which the support device 1 is arranged and / or against a surface that protrudes from the ground or the other surface, for example, against a wall or a tree.
[0041] The first pivot angle limiting device 13 limits the pivot angle of the floor support component 12 relative to the backrest 2 to a predefined angle. The pivot angle is limited such that the backrest 2 cannot pivot further away from the floor support device 4.
[0042] In the first embodiment, the first pivot angle limiting device 13 has a rod-like support element 14 with a first rod end 14.1 and a second rod end 14.2 and with a predetermined length L. The predetermined length L defines the length of connecting elements of the rod-like support element 14 and not necessarily the absolute length of the rod-like support element 14. The rod-like support element 14 is pivotally connected to the backrest 2 at the first rod end 14.1 in a region of an end that is located at the top during intended use of the support device, i.e. closer to the top end than to the bottom end.
[0043] The ground support component 12 has a plurality of ground support component fixing devices 15 along the second longitudinal direction LR2, and the rod-like support element 14 can be connected to the ground support component 12 at the second rod end 14.2 by means of the ground support component fixing devices 15, each at a predefined location on the ground support component 12. The ground support component fixing devices 15 are each formed by a groove in the ground support component 12, so that the ground support component 12, in the embodiment shown, has a plurality of grooves along the second longitudinal direction LR2 as ground support component fixing devices 15. The rod-like support element 14 has a transverse pin at the second end 14.2, via which the rod-like support element 14 can be fixed to the ground support component 12 by means of the ground support component fixing devices 15.In an alternative embodiment, only one ground support component fixing device 15 is provided. In further alternative embodiments, holes or projections, such as bolts, pins, studs, etc., are provided instead of the grooves.
[0044] The support device 1 in the first embodiment further comprises a seat cushion 18, which is connected to a lower end of the backrest 2 during normal use of the support device 1. In alternative embodiments, no seat cushion 18 is provided; instead, the body sits directly on the floor, and the back rests on the support device 1.
[0045] Furthermore, the support device 1 has a headrest 19 at the end of the backrest 2 that is at the top during intended use. The support device 1 further has a mounting device 20, with which the headrest 19 is mounted on the backrest 2 such that it is adjustable and lockable along the first longitudinal direction LR1. Furthermore, the mounting device 20 is designed such that the headrest 19 is adjustable and lockable along a direction perpendicular to the first longitudinal direction LR1 and at a right angle to the backrest surface 3. In alternative embodiments, only one of the fixing and locking options is provided. In further alternative embodiments, no headrest is provided.
[0046] Fig. 3 shows an isometric view of a second embodiment of the support device 1 from an angle from behind.
[0047] The second embodiment of the support device 1 differs from the first embodiment in that, unlike the first embodiment, no ground support component fixing devices are provided on the ground support component 12, but rather support element fixing devices 16 are provided on the rod-like support element 14. In this embodiment, the support element fixing devices 16 are formed from a plurality of openings in the rod-like support element 14 along its length. The ground support component 12 has a pin (not shown here) that can enter the openings of the support element fixing devices 16, and the rod-like support element 14 can be fixed to the ground support component 12 by means of the support element fixing devices 16.
[0048] In the second embodiment, the ground support component 12 also has two ground support component sections 12', 12" pivotally connected to one another about a second pivot axis 21 perpendicular to the second longitudinal direction LR2 of the ground support component 12. The ground support component 12 further has a second pivot angle limiting device 17 which limits a pivot angle of the two ground support component sections 12', 12".
[0049] The second pivot angle limiting device 17 has two pivot angle limiting device sections 17', 17" pivotally connected to one another about a third pivot axis 22 perpendicular to the second longitudinal direction LR2 of the ground support component 12. One end of one of the pivot angle limiting device sections 17" is connected to one of the ground support component sections 12" of the ground support component 12 in the region of the first ground support component end 12.1, and one end of the other of the pivot angle limiting device sections 17' is connected to one of the ground support component sections 12' of the ground support component 12 in the region of the second ground support component end 12.2. In alternative embodiments, the second pivot angle limiting device 17 can be formed, for example, by a rope-like element.
[0050] In an alternative embodiment (not shown), the first pivot angle limiting device is not designed as shown in these two embodiments, but rather the first pivot angle limiting device comprises a rope-like element with a first fastening point and a second fastening point and a predefined length therebetween. In this embodiment, the fastening points are formed as knots, loops, or other connection options, as was the case with the rope-like fastening device 11 in the first embodiment, whereby the maximum pivot angle between the backrest 2 and the floor support device 4 can be adjusted by changing the predefined length.For this purpose, the rope-like element is connected at the first fastening point in a region of an end of the backrest 2 which is located at the bottom during intended use, i.e. closer to this end, and is connected at the second fastening point in a region of the second end 12.2 of the floor support component 12 to the floor support device 4.
